I have a specific question regarding the support for hierarchical models in Dynamax. Is it possible to enhance the following example with additional layers of complexity? For instance, could I modify the MLP model in the nonlinear Gaussian SSM example to include higher levels of nonlinearities, such as:

  • State transition:
    $$a_t = f(a_{t-1}) + w_t, \quad w_t \sim \mathcal{N}(0, 0.01 I)$$

  • Parameter update:
    $$\theta_t = a_t \theta_{t-1} + q_t, \quad q_t \sim \mathcal{N}(0, 0.01 I)$$

  • Observation model:
    $$y_t = h(\theta_t, x_t) + r_t, \quad r_t \sim \mathcal{N}(0, \sigma^2)$$

This is a simplified representation of the model I am considering. Thank you for your dedication and excellent work!
